General Hospital Spoilers: Sidwell Targets Justine to Trap Sonny as Danger Escalates

A wave of life-threatening danger and intense psychological warfare is crashing down on Port Charles, leaving beloved residents fighting for survival on multiple fronts. For Wednesday, July 1, 2026, the latest General Hospital spoilers video delivers a heart-pounding look at an episode defined by split-second decisions and escalating crises. From an unconscious man fighting for his next breath to a tense confrontation over a child’s safety, the emotional stakes have never been higher.

Nina Confronts a Nightmare as Jack Stops Breathing

The most harrowing development in the preview clip centers on a stark medical emergency involving Nina Reeves (Cynthia Watros) and Jack Brennan (Chris McKenna). The drama takes a terrifying turn when Nina comes across an unconscious Jack. The situation shifts from alarming to outright critical when Nina realizes that Jack is not breathing.

A Critical Race Against Time

For Nina, discovering Jack in such a vulnerable, life-threatening state forces her into a high-stakes crisis. With every passing second counting, his survival hangs entirely in the balance.

As Nina processes the horrifying reality of the situation, the immediate question remains whether she can stabilize him or get medical intervention before it is too late.

Gio Defies Danger While Detective Joe Sounds the Alarm

Meanwhile, local dynamics are growing increasingly volatile. Giovanni “Gio” Palmieri (Giovanni Mazza) is demonstrating a fierce, perhaps dangerous sense of loyalty to Sonny Corinthos (Maurice Benard). In a tense moment, Gio looks Sonny in the eye and firmly declares, “I have no intention of moving out of your house.” While his steadfast commitment to staying by Sonny’s side is clear, residing in the mob boss’s direct orbit is rarely a low-risk housing plan. Given the constant target on Sonny’s back, it seems highly possible that Gio might want to keep a packed bag ready to go just in case the living situation implodes.

At the hospital, a battered and bruised Detective Joe (Jonathan Bennett) is doing everything in his power to keep the city safe. Having been brutally knocked out by Cassius, poor Joe is forced to try to function through a severe head injury. Despite the trauma, his instincts remain sharp enough to sound the alarm. Clinging to his phone, Joe commands, “Put out an APB on Detective Nathan West.” Joe knows the clock is ticking, and getting that All-Points Bulletin out is the only way to intercept a dangerous impostor.

Cody Confronts the Impostor in a Fight for James

Joe’s alert comes none too soon, as a major confrontation unfolds elsewhere. Having just received Felicia Scorpio’s (Kristina Wagner) urgent warning that “Nathan” (Ryan Paevey) is not who he claims to be, Cody Bell (Josh Kelly) springs into action.

Cody manages to intercept young James West (Gary James Fuller) and the fake Nathan right as they are on the verge of departing. Stepping directly into harm’s way, Cody calls out, “James, wait! You can’t leave.”

With the truth about the fake detective exposed, this sudden intervention could easily turn into a very ugly and violent fight. Cody is fully prepared to do whatever it takes to keep James safe, but confronting a cornered and desperate criminal means the potential consequences for everyone involved are terrifyingly unpredictable.

High-Voltage Escapes and Sinister Traps

The tension is equally palpable over at Wyndemere, where an escape attempt is currently balanced on a razor’s edge. Liesl Obrecht (Kathleen Gati) is poised to use her wits to break out of their makeshift prison cell, preparing to cut an electrical wire to short-circuit the door. Watching the risky maneuver unfold, a skeptical Josslyn Jacks (Eden McCoy) questions the play, asking, “You sure that’s the right wire?” The duo find themselves right on the precipice of freedom, assuming Liesl’s calculated gamble works—and doesn’t accidentally turn into a fried-Wyndemere special that leaves them worse off than before.

In another part of town, the sinister Jenz Sidwell (Carlo Rota) is advancing his own dark agenda. Sidwell corners ADA Justine Turner (Nazneen Contractor), ominous telling her, “Let’s find out how valuable you really are.”

It appears that Sidwell is pulling the strings on a massive trap, and Sonny is being successfully lured right into it. By holding Justine captive, Sidwell seems poised to use her as ultimate bait to bring the mobster down—a terrifying predicament that is definitely not the career pivot the legal official had in mind.

Finally, the web of secrets entangles Carly Spencer (Laura Wright) as well. Cullum crosses paths with Carly, delivering the cryptic line that she “saved him a trip.” What exactly Cullum has in store for Carly remains a mystery, but her knack for landing in the middle of Port Charles’ biggest secrets ensures that whatever comes next will shake up the canvas.

With lives hanging by a literal wire and an impostor cornered, Wednesday’s episode is set to alter the fates of everyone involved. Will Cody be able to protect James from a desperate fake Nathan, or will the standoff take a tragic turn?
